Q: Is 13,089,079 a Prime Number?
A: No, 13,089,079 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 13089079 can be evenly divided by 1 2,029 6,451 and 13,089,079, with no remainder.
Since 13,089,079 cannot be divided by just 1 and 13,089,079, it is not a prime number.
